Are You a CARER?
Did you know there is support available if you are a carer?
You may be looking after a spouse/relative/friend and just assumed the role without calling yourself a carer
If this is the case, you may be a carer. More importantly, you may need help and support yourself.

A Carer’s Assessment is a discussion with a healthcare or social worker about what services are available to help you.
The assessment can be done in person or over the telephone.
Did you know that a Carer can receive:
- Practical Support
- Financial Support
- Benefits advice
- Support at work
- Local groups
- Respite care
Types of Support:
1. Financial – Benefits are available related to costs related to disability, low income or unemployment. Arrange a carer’s assessment to find out more.
2. Employment support - Flexible Working Hours, How to get back into employment, Protection from discrimination, Right to parental leave, taking time off in emergencies.
3. Carer’s Health – Respite care, time to look after your own health, GP appointments, Flu vaccines, routine health checks, Improve wellbeing.
4. Social Support – Counselling, reducing social isolation
